Can an interest deduction be claimed for investing in a hybrid trust?

This movie explains the decision of the Full Federal Court of Australia in Forrest v Commissioner of Taxation.  It is an important decision that was handed down on 5 February 2010.  It concerned whether an individual could obtain an income tax deduction for interest on money borrowed to invest in a hybrid trust (a trust with both a discretionary and a fixed component). 

In the movie you will see why the Commissioner argued that over $800,000 interest was not deductible and why the Administrative Appeals Tribunal said the Commissioner was correct.  The taxpayer appealed to the Full Federal Court (3 judges) against this decision. 

This case also has implications for the outcome of the Bamford case to be heard by the High Court.
